“…For most enteric pathogens attachment is a prerequisite for invasion and effective delivery of toxins to the intestinal epithelial cells (Giannella, 1981). Thus adhesiveness to cell cultures has been used as a measure of virulence; and since the invasion of tissue culture cells correlates with the capacity of enteropathogenic bacteria to invade intestinal epithelial cells in vivo (Giannella et al 1973), it is likely that the activity of these campylobacter strains towards the cell cultures is a reflexion of their pathogenicity.…”

“…This entry process resembles phagocytosis and results in intracellular bacteria enclosed within membrane-bound vacuoles. To study the molecular details of the initial entry process, in vitro assays have been developed for quantitating the ability of Salmonella to adhere to and enter cultured mammalian cells (7)(8)(9)(10)(11)(12)(13). Recent studies (14)(15)(16) have examined the interaction of Salmonella with epithelial cells that have formed polarized monolayers in vitro (17).…”
